#0c1ec2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c1ec2 is composed of 4.7% red, 11.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 234.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 40.4%. #0c1ec2 color hex could be obtained by blending #183cff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#0c1ec2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c1ec2 has RGB values of R:12, G:30,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 794306.

Shades and Tints of #0c1ec2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010109 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c1ec2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63646b is the less saturated color, while #0418ca is the most saturated one.
